I've made the decision to go to a TH400 next spring. I've already started to gather some of the "small stuff" (H&R transmission mount and a B&M 3 speed reverse pattern shifter gate plate) that's going to be needed to do a clean conversion. I want everything to work properly (like the back up lights and neutral switch also). The only thing left to do will be to determine the how much will the driveshaft need to be shortened and to get a TH400 transmission slip yoke.
